About USEA United Maritime Corporation

United Maritime Corp is an international shipping company currently specializing in world-wide seaborne transportation services. It currently operates a fleet of dry bulk vessels, comprising Panamax, Capesize and Kamsarmax vessels. Its vessels include Dukeship, Nisea, Cretansea, Chrisea, Synthesea, and Exelixsea.

About AEON AEON Biopharma Inc.

AEON Biopharma Inc is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of ABP-450 (prabotulinumtoxinA), a biosimilar to Botox (onabotulinumtoxinA), for therapeutic indications. The company is advancing ABP-450 through the biosimilar regulatory pathway and holds development and commercialization rights across multiple international markets.
